使用Eclipse3.01+MinGW3.1配置标准开发环境详解
使用Eclipse3.01+MinGW3.1配置标准开发环境详解 使用Eclipse3.01+MinGW3.1配置标准开发环境详解 使用Eclipse3.01+MinGW3.1配置标准开发环境详解 使用Eclipse3.01+MinGW3.1配置标准开发环境详解 使用Eclipse3.01+MinGW3.1配置标准开发环境详解 【Eclipse 3.01 + MinGW 3.1 配置标准C/C++开发环境详解】 在软件开发领域,尤其是C/C++编程中,选择一个高效且适合自己的开发环境至关重要。本教程将详细介绍如何使用Eclipse 3.01集成开发环境(IDE)配合MinGW 3.1来构建标准的C/C++开发平台,这个组合不仅免费,而且功能强大,适合初学者和专业人士使用。 Eclipse原本是为Java开发设计的,但通过添加C/C++ Development Toolkit(CDT),它可以成为一个优秀的C++ IDE。下面是配置步骤: 1. **软件准备**: - 下载并安装Eclipse 3.01:访问官方网站http://www.eclipse.org获取最新版本。 - 下载并安装CDT:在Eclipse更新站点http://update.eclipse.org/tools/cdt/releases/new/选择适合的版本,如cdt-2.1.0-win32.x86。 - 下载并安装MinGW 3.1:可以从SourceForge的下载页面http://prdownloads.sf.net/mingw/MinGW-3.1.0-1.exe?download获取。 2. **环境配置**: - 安装MinGW后,添加环境变量:在“系统变量”的Path中,加入MinGW的bin目录,例如`C:\MinGW\MinGW\bin;`。 - 将`MinGW\bin\mingw32-make.exe`重命名为`make.exe`。 3. **Eclipse安装**: - 安装Eclipse后,将CDT的features和plugins目录复制到Eclipse安装目录下。 - 首次启动Eclipse时,选择或创建一个工作空间(workspace),这是项目文件的存放位置。 4. **创建C++项目**: - 选择“文件”>“新建”>“项目”>“标准Make C++项目”。 - 在Navigator视图中右键点击项目名,选择“新建”>“文件”,创建C++源文件,如`Hello.cpp`。 5. **编写源代码**: - 在`Hello.cpp`中输入C++代码,例如简单的"Hello World"程序: ```cpp #include <iostream> using namespace std; int main() { cout << "你好 Eclipse!\n"; system("pause"); } ``` 6. **设置编译控制**: - 为了编译源文件,需要配置Make Targets:选择“窗口”>“显示视图”>“Make Targets”。 - 右键点击项目名,选择“添加Make目标”,输入Target Name:`MAKE`,Builder Command:`g++ Hello.cpp -g -o run`。 至此,你已经成功地配置了一个使用Eclipse 3.01和MinGW 3.1的标准C/C++开发环境。你可以在这个环境中编写、编译、运行和调试C++代码。Eclipse的特性,如代码自动完成、错误检测、调试器等,将极大地提升你的开发效率。 值得注意的是,虽然这个教程基于Eclipse 3.01和MinGW 3.1,但原理相同,适用于Eclipse的后续版本以及MinGW的更新版本。随着时间的推移,确保升级到最新版本以获得最新的特性和修复。同时,Eclipse社区提供了丰富的插件,可以扩展其功能,适应更多编程语言和框架的需求。































剩余7页未读,继续阅读


- 粉丝: 6
我的内容管理 展开
我的资源 快来上传第一个资源
我的收益
登录查看自己的收益我的积分 登录查看自己的积分
我的C币 登录后查看C币余额
我的收藏
我的下载
下载帮助


最新资源
- 单片机温度控制系统设计方案.doc
- 数字技术与网络传播背景下的广告生存形态最新年文档.doc
- 浅析电气工程及其自动化的发展创新.docx
- C5单片机电子台历的设计与制作.ppt
- (源码)基于C语言汇编的EulixOS训练营在线作业.zip
- 套筒零件加工工艺分析研究编程.doc
- 企业IT建设与项目管理思想.docx
- 株洲服装产业物联网项目市场风险识别与衡量.doc
- 电子商务-本科专业审核评估自评分析报告模板.doc
- 信息与通信技术进展:计算理论与实践研讨会
- 全国计算机等级历年考试四级网络工程师过关练习711章.doc
- JSPSmart题库及试卷管理模块的与开发.doc
- 计算机网络技术在电子信息工程中的应用(1).docx
- 计算机网络安全论文(乱凑的).doc
- 我国P2P网络信贷信用风险影响因素分析.docx
- 基于简单神经网络模型实现图片分类的方法


